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
094477328 22006 7950801
0390927359 93
0390927359 93
627778364 021496661 378373822
All about undefined
Interested in learning more?
0390927359 93
627778364 021496661 378373822
See more
64406297 59045656 49266306
90 322 25
See more
139 840813615 81034753573
59586 33 61 301515
See more